The decision to replace or upgrade an existing wood deck or porch often hinges on the severity of wear and tear over time. Common issues include cracked or splintered wood, warped or uneven surfaces, and deterioration of support posts or framing. These problems can compromise safety and stability, prompting homeowners to consider a full replacement. Conversely, some may opt for upgrades that improve aesthetics or functionality, such as installing new decking materials, adding railing or lighting, or extending the existing structure. Property owners often look up when to replace or upgrade an existing wood deck or porch after noticing signs of wear and deterioration. Over time, exposure to weather elements can cause wood to crack, warp, or rot, making the structure unsafe or less visually appealing. Additionally, older decks may lack modern features or design elements that enhance outdoor living spaces, prompting homeowners to consider upgrades. When these issues become apparent, local contractors who specialize in deck and porch services can assess the condition of the existing structure and recommend appropriate solutions, whether that involves repairs, upgrades, or complete replacement.

Other common reasons property owners seek advice on deck or porch replacement include structural instability or increased maintenance needs. If a deck’s support beams or joists show signs of weakening or sagging, it might be safer and more cost-effective to replace rather than repair. Similarly, if a porch or deck is difficult to maintain or no longer meets aesthetic preferences, upgrading with newer materials and designs can improve both function and appearance. When should I consider replacing my wood deck or porch? Signs such as rotting, significant warping, or widespread splintering indicate it may be time to replace or upgrade an existing wood deck or porch, and local contractors can assess the condition to recommend the best course of action.

How can I tell if my wood deck or porch needs an upgrade? If your deck shows visible damage like loose boards, rusted fasteners, or persistent mold and mildew, it may benefit from an upgrade, and local service providers can help evaluate and improve its safety and appearance.

What are common reasons to replace an old wood deck or porch? Common reasons include structural deterioration, extensive decay, or outdated design that no longer fits the home, with local contractors able to provide options for replacement or upgrades.

Is it better to repair or replace my wood deck or porch? When repairs become extensive or cost-prohibitive, replacing the entire structure might be more practical, and local pros can determine the most effective solution based on the condition of the deck or porch.

What upgrades can improve the longevity of my wood deck or porch? Upgrades such as using treated or composite materials, adding protective finishes, or reinforcing structural elements can extend its lifespan; local contractors can advise on suitable improvements.
